快科技11月7日消息,iPhone作為全球手機行業(yè)的領頭者,大家如今已經(jīng)再熟悉不過了,但今天一則熱搜卻突然引起了大家的深思——為什么iPhone只有P大寫?
雖然經(jīng)常見到,但很多人見到這個話題卻突然一愣:對啊,為什么呢?
不只是iPhone,還有iPad、iPod、iMac等多款蘋果產(chǎn)品都是如此。
其實,這樣的命名是遵循了一項規(guī)則——駱駝式命名法(CamelCase,又稱駝峰式命名法)。
這是電腦程式編寫時的一套命名規(guī)則(慣例),是程序員們?yōu)榱俗约旱拇a能更容易的在同行之間交流,所以多采取統(tǒng)一的可讀性比較好的命名方式。
駱駝式命名法就是當變量名或函數(shù)名是由一個或多個單詞連結在一起,而構成的唯一識別字時,第一個單詞以小寫字母開始;從第二個單詞開始以后的每個單詞的首字母都采用大寫字母。
例如:myFirstName、myLastName,這樣的變量名看上去就像駱駝峰一樣此起彼伏,故得名。
另外,駱駝式命名法還有“小駝峰法”和“大駝峰法”之分。
小駝峰法就是像iPhone那樣,除第一個單詞之外,其他單詞首字母大寫。
大駝峰法則是把第一個單詞的首字母也大寫了,比如MyDrivers、public class DataBaseUse等。
不過,駱駝式命名法的命名規(guī)則可視為一種慣例,并無絕對與強制,為的是增加識別和可讀性。
本文鏈接:http://www.www897cc.com/showinfo-22-17326-0.html為什么iPhone只有P大寫 原因揭曉:來自“駝峰命名法”
聲明:本網(wǎng)頁內(nèi)容旨在傳播知識,若有侵權等問題請及時與本網(wǎng)聯(lián)系,我們將在第一時間刪除處理。郵件:2376512515@qq.com